Application Instructions

Sporan EC2 can be applied through most standard or filed type sprayers after dilution and mixing with water warmer than 45°F. Spray coverage should be uniform and complete.

Add one quarter to one half ounce of Sporan EC2 to a gallon of water under agitation containing water of 45°F or greater before filling to desired level. When combining with other products, such as adjuvants, insecticides, fungicides, or fertilizers, add these products first when the tank is approximately 1/2 full. Ensure that there is good agitation while mixing for complete emulsification. Maintain agitation during spray application.
See label for a complete list of rates for specific uses.

Active Ingredients

Rosemary Oil ......................16.00%
Clove Oil .............................10.00%
Thyme Oil ...........................10.00%
Peppermint Oil ....................02.00%
Other Ingredients* ..............62.00%
*Butyl lactate, polyglyceryl oleate

The Manufacturer has claimed that this is a 25(b) Exempt Product: “Because EPA has determined that certain "minimum risk pesticides" pose little to no risk to human health or the environment, EPA has exempted them from the requirement that they be registered under the Federal Insecticide, Fungicide, and Rodenticide Act (FIFRA)."...EPA

25(b) Exempt pesticides are often allowed for use on day care centers and K-8 school grounds in states where pesticide bans are in effect, please check your local laws to be verify.
